What Determines MPPT Photovoltaic Energy Storage System Prices?
MPPT (Maximum Power Point Tracking) technology maximizes energy harvest from solar panels. However, prices vary widely based on:
- System Capacity: Residential systems (5-10 kW) average $8,000-$15,000, while commercial setups (50-100 kW) range from $40,000-$90,000.
- Battery Type: Lithium-ion batteries add $4,000-$10,000 to the total cost but offer longer lifespans than lead-acid alternatives.
- MPPT Controller Efficiency: High-end controllers with 98-99% efficiency cost 20-30% more than basic models.

Global Market Trends Impacting MPPT System Costs
Did you know? The MPPT energy storage market is projected to grow at 12.4% CAGR through 2030. Here's why prices are shifting:
- Raw material costs for lithium dropped 18% in Q1 2024.
- Government incentives in the EU and U.S. now cover 30-50% of installation costs.
- Emerging manufacturers in Southeast Asia offer systems 15-20% cheaper than European counterparts.

How to Reduce Your MPPT Photovoltaic System Costs
Want to save without compromising quality? Try these strategies:
- Opt for hybrid systems combining grid-tied and off-grid capabilities
- Leverage seasonal discounts (Q4 typically offers 8-12% price reductions)
- Consider refurbished industrial-grade components with 80-90% cost savings
Real-World Example: Farm Installation in Texas
A 20 kW MPPT system installed in 2023 achieved 22% cost savings through:
- Bulk purchasing of panels
- Using tier-2 batteries with 10-year warranties
- Applying for federal tax credits
FAQ: MPPT Photovoltaic Energy Storage System Prices
- Q: How long until I break even on my investment?A: Most systems pay for themselves in 6-8 years through energy savings.
- Q: Do prices include installation?A: Typically, quotes cover equipment only – factor in 15-20% extra for professional installation.
